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| megachile dorsalis | small tortoiseshell |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(hewan) | Animalia (hewan) |
| Phylum same | Arthropoda (Artropoda) | Arthropoda (Artropoda) |
| Class same | Insecta (serangga) | Insecta (serangga) |
| Order | Hymenoptera (Ants, Bees & Wasps) |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) |
| Family | Megachilidae | Nymphalidae (Brush-footed Butterflies) |
| Genus | Megachile | Aglais |
| Species | Megachile leachella | Aglais urticae |
Evolutionary Relationship
megachile dorsalis and small tortoiseshell share a common ancestor at the Class level: Insecta. (serangga)
